SMS Tracking

For those without regular internet access, DGIP offers an SMS-based tracking service. Simply send your 11-digit token number to 9988, and you will receive an instant reply with your application status. Ensure your correct mobile number is provided during the application process to receive these updates.

Tracking for Overseas Applicants

Pakistani missions abroad, such as the Consulate General of Pakistan in Dubai, provide dedicated online tracking portals. Applicants in the UAE, for example, can enter their tracking number on the consulate’s website to check the status of their passport or attestation documents. Similar systems are available at other Pakistani missions worldwide, including those in Germany, Canada, and Italy.

Physical Collection

Once your passport status shows “Ready for Collection,” you can pick it up in person from the relevant passport office or consulate. Bring your original token slip and a valid photo ID. If you opted for courier delivery, use the provided tracking number to monitor delivery via the courier’s website.

Passport Types, Fees, and Processing Times

Pakistan issues several types of passports, including ordinary, official, diplomatic, and the new e-passport. Fees and processing times vary by type, validity, and service level (normal, urgent, or fast track). Ordinary passports (valid for 5 or 10 years) are the most common, while e-passports offer enhanced security with embedded microchips. Urgent processing is available at a higher fee for those who need their passport quickly. Standard processing typically takes 10–15 working days, while urgent processing can be completed in 4–5 days.
